The Growing Popularity of Betting Platforms in Kenya
Kenya’s betting scene has expanded dramatically over the last decade, becoming a significant part of the country’s entertainment and digital economy. With mobile technology widely accessible and services like M-Pesa making transactions easier, betting has become more approachable for many. The variety of platforms now available allows both casual players and serious punters a diverse range of opportunities, from sports to virtual games.

Popular Sports and Games on Kenyan Betting Sites
Football remains king across Kenya’s betting platforms, with leagues from the English Premier League to local Kenyan Premier League matches drawing the bulk of bets. Other sports like rugby, basketball, and even niche options such as darts or boxing are also readily available.
In addition to sports betting, virtual games and casino-style offerings have gained traction, often powered by renowned providers like Pragmatic Play or Evolution Gaming. These games frequently feature engaging graphics and live dealer options, adding a fresh dimension to online betting experiences.
Understanding Payment Methods and Security Measures
One of the key reasons many find betting sites in Kenya accessible is the seamless integration with local payment systems, especially M-Pesa, which dominates mobile money transfers. This allows users to deposit and withdraw funds quickly without the need for traditional bank accounts. Other options like Airtel Money and bank transfers are also common, ensuring convenience across different user preferences.
Security is another crucial aspect. Reputable betting sites in Kenya employ SSL encryption and adhere to guidelines set by the Betting Control and Licensing Board (BCLB), which regulates the industry. This framework helps maintain fairness and protects users’ personal and financial data.

Responsible Betting and Its Importance
While the appeal of betting sites in Kenya is undeniable, it’s vital to remember that gambling involves risks. Responsible betting practices are essential to prevent negative consequences, such as financial strain or addiction. Many platforms offer features like deposit limits and self-exclusion tools to help users maintain control.
Being mindful of one’s limits and viewing betting as a form of entertainment rather than a guaranteed income source can make the experience more enjoyable and sustainable in the long term.
